Here are some tests on 2 Marvell SoC (I do not have dove platforms at hand and did not collect the results for A370): - Kirkwood 88F6282 (Feroceon 88FR131 rev 1) at 1.6GHz - Armada XP (mv78230, i.e. 2 core @1.2GHz) The targets are AES ECB and CBC encryption (decryption is similar performance-wise), done w/ tcrypt (mode=500 passed to tcrypt module). For each SoC, the various tests done by tcrypt are the following: AES ECB/CBC encryption: t 0 (128 bit key, 16 byte blocks) t 1 (128 bit key, 64 byte blocks) t 2 (128 bit key, 256 byte blocks) t 3 (128 bit key, 1024 byte blocks) t 4 (128 bit key, 8192 byte blocks) t 5 (192 bit key, 16 byte blocks) t 6 (192 bit key, 64 byte blocks) t 7 (192 bit key, 256 byte blocks) t 8 (192 bit key, 1024 byte blocks) t 9 (192 bit key, 8192 byte blocks) t 10 (256 bit key, 16 byte blocks) t 11 (256 bit key, 64 byte blocks) t 12 (256 bit key, 256 byte blocks) t 13 (256 bit key, 1024 byte blocks) t 14 (256 bit key, 8192 byte blocks) The three columns provide the value for software implementation (aes-asm), current driver (if available for that SoC), submitted v0.
